The real estate industry is driven by the latest technologies to standardize the operational infrastructure.
FREMONT, CA: Unimaginable progress in the functionalities of the real estate business makes it more involuntary for people who try to sell and buy properties. Tech-based platforms provide easy navigation for property owners to publicize their offerings with facilities and value ranges to potential buyers.
Furthermore, platforms allied with cloud computing, Artificial Intelligence (AI), and blockchain offer more diverse benefits. Some of these incredible technologies are listed below.

• Blockchain on the Rise
Presently, blockchain is one of the best technologies and enables CRE. This technology helps real estate experts design a standard leasing and buying database and sales transactions beyond several entities, like tenants, operators, owners, investors, and service providers, who access, provide, and modify distinct information.
Additionally, blockchain can mitigate the entities' interests in data integrity by building transparent property-related record-keeping systems, like liens, property entitlement, financing, and tenancy.
• Cloud Computing Promising Huge Benefits
The intro of cloud-based platforms guarantees huge profits for the real estate business. This technology can decrease operational expenses, further the processes, enhance data security, and build better workflow consistency.
Cloud-based operational infrastructures decrease the need to control and manage in-house servers. Moreover, the cloud streamlines information sharing and interaction abilities between experts and clients with cutting-edge data security characteristics.
• Artificial Intelligence
The AI-influenced operational infrastructures for the real estate business have created lots of buzz in the recent market. This technology brings intelligent property recommendation systems and saves time and cost for realtors to search for and advise the perfect houses for their customers.
AI-based chatbots at the property selling platforms offer 24/7 availability to guide customers, boosting customer satisfaction to a higher level and selling property instantly. There is more on the benefits list of AI that comprises immediate information sharing, virtual property tours, and automating the scheduling of property visits and document scanning.
These high-level trends contribute to analyzing new real estate business opportunities and accessing future-generation solutions to satisfy the growing demands of tech-driven consumers.
